WORST
(noun) the weakest effort or poorest achievement one is capable of
"it was the worst he had ever done on a test"
(noun) the greatest damage or wickedness of which one is capable
"the invaders did their worst", "so pure of heart that his worst is another man's best"
(noun) the least favorable outcome
"the worst that could happen"
(verb) defeat thoroughly
"He mopped up the floor with his opponents"
synonyms : mop up , pip , rack up , whip(adj.) (superlative of `bad') most wanting in quality or value or condition
"the worst player on the team", "the worst weather of the year"
(adverb) to the highest degree of inferiority or badness
"She suffered worst of all", "schools were the worst hit by government spending cuts", "the worst dressed person present"
